Job summary

A local restaurant in Kelowna is seeking an experienced individual to manage daily operations and finances. The role involves analyzing budgets, supervising staff, and ensuring customer satisfaction. Candidates should have a secondary school graduation certificate and at least 2 years of related experience. This position is on-site with no remote work options.

Qualifications

  • 2 years to less than 3 years of experience required.

Responsibilities

  • Analyze budget to boost and maintain the restaurant’s profits.
  • Evaluate daily operations.
  • Modify food preparation methods and menu prices according to the restaurant budget.
  • Monitor revenues to determine labour cost.
  • Plan and organize daily operations.
  • Set staff work schedules.
  • Supervise staff.
  • Train staff.
  • Balance cash and complete balance sheets, cash reports and related forms.
  • Cost products and services.
  • Organize and maintain inventory.
  • Address customers' complaints or concerns.
  • Provide customer service.
